The Property Shop are delighted to be able to offer this detached character cottage, which has been extended to provide attractive, spacious accommodation. The property is situated in the very popular Broadland village of Upton, which benefits from an excellent pub/restaurant owned by the local community, also a small shop. There are lovely views and walks by the river, particularly along Upton Dyke. The cottage benefits from spectacular open views across protected wildlife land and the vendors often see many species of wildlife, including birds of prey and deer. Accommodation comprises: entrance hall, living room, dining room, kitchen, utility room, master bedroom with en-suite, bathroom and two further bedrooms upstairs. There are various outbuildings, workshops and sheds. A lovely summerhouse sits at the bottom of the garden by the stream and overlooking stunning views. Outside
The property is approached via a driveway leading to double gates and a further driveway providing parking for many vehicles and storage space for boat/caravan. The front garden is laid to lawn and enclosed by hedging. A gate to the side leads to the rear garden, which is mainly laid to lawn and planted with a variety of mature trees and shrubs. There is a wisteria-covered pergola, camellias and two raised beds. There is a large, raised deck overlooking the lovely marshes. Currently there is a sauna and a hot tub (available by separate negotiation). There is also a large outbuilding with power and light, two further sheds and a summerhouse at the bottom of the garden with views over the stream and marshes. There is sufficient land and outbuildings for business opportunities.
